K is the set of consonant letters in the English alphabet h ∈ K Is this true or false?
Stells [14]
∈ <--- This symbol means "an element of". According to your question, you would like to know if statement h ∈ K is valid. That statement is true because the letter "h" is a consonant and set K is a set of consonants. If we look at set K, it should look like this: 

K = {B, C, D, F, G, H, J, K, L, M, N, P, Q, R, S, T, V, W, X, Y, Z}. As seen in this set, the letter "h" is the 6th element. 

Therefore, h ∈ K is a valid statement. The answer is: TRUE.

Question 7: 10 pts
levacccp [35]

The teacher ordered the students in 24 ways.

We have given that the total number of students is 4.

4 students are assigned to give presentations.

We have to find the arrangement of the 4 students.

<h3>What is the arrangement?</h3>

An arrangement (or ordering) of a set of objects is called a permutation. (We can also arrange just part of the set of objects.)

In a permutation, the order that we arrange the objects n is important.

4 students can be arranged by 4! ways.

4!=4*3*2*1\\  =12*2\\=24

Therefore option 3 is correct.

The teacher ordered the students in 24 ways.
